50 Best Restaurants in The Mid-Coast Region, Maine

Bath Brewing Company

$$ Fodor's choice

You'll feel right at home in this intimate modern pub, offering casual dining on two floors plus an upper outdoor deck. The beer ranges from IPAs to stouts and sours. The menu, which changes with the seasons, includes imaginative light dishes as well as well-prepared entrées. 

Dolphin Marina and Restaurant

$$$ Fodor's choice

At the end of Harpswell Neck—next to the Dolphin Marina, where diners often arrive by boat—this popular restaurant serves one of the best fish chowders on the coast. Take in the excellent views through a wall of windows or from the outdoor deck as you enjoy your equally excellent chowder—or your lobster stew, crab or lobster roll, or chicken or beef entrée.

515 Basin Point Rd. South, Harpswell, Maine, 04079, USA
207-833–6000
Known For
  • exceptional food and service
  • blueberry muffins come with fish chowder and lobster stew
  • spectacular seaside setting
Restaurants Details
Rate Includes: Closed Nov.–Apr.

Fish House Market

$$ Fodor's choice

Although everything served at this seafood shack and market beside Fish Beach is delicious and simply prepared, the crab roll—a large, split-top roll buttered and griddled and stuffed with fresh, sweet, mayo-tossed crabmeat—may just be the best on the Maine coast. Order at the window, carry your tray to a picnic table inches from the water, and lap up the view of lobster boats in the harbor. You can also have your order packed to go. 

Recommended Fodor's Video

Five Islands Lobster Company

$$ Fodor's choice

Drive to the end of Route 127 and relax in the breezes off Sheepscot Bay in the tiny fishing village of Five Islands, not too far from Reid State Park. This award-winning lobster shack overlooks at least five islands from its perch atop the working wharf, and you can watch lobstermen unload their traps onto the dock while you feast on fresh lobster rolls or a full lobster dinner and sample Maine-made ice cream. If you've got a big craving for lobster, order the Big Boy lobster roll, with double the amount of meat in a large roll. The “secret” to the famous tartar sauce is dill. This is a BYOB place, so bring a cooler with your preferred beverages, settle at a picnic table, and enjoy the sublime setting.

1447 5 Islands Rd., Georgetown, Maine, 04548, USA
207-371–2990
Known For
  • authentic Maine setting with gorgeous scenery
  • excellent lobster rolls
  • BYOB
Restaurants Details
Rate Includes: Closed Wed. in summer; closed weekdays spring and fall; closed early May–early Oct.

Met Coffee House

$ Fodor's choice

Sit at a table to enjoy a bagel, croissant, Belgian waffles, or quiche at breakfast or a cold or toasted sandwich or flatbread at lunch. At any time of the day, sink into a comfy chair or sofa to indulge in a great cup of regular coffee, an "artistic" latte (try the Heath Bar version), or one of 15 specialty hot chocolates, including almond joy and peppermint.

Moody's Diner

$ Fodor's choice

Whether you sit at a booth in the dining room or at the counter of this eatery, established in 1927, chances are, you'll soon be chatting with your neighbors. The multipage menu has all the breakfast standards (including fresh doughnuts every morning) and comfort-food lunch and dinner classics—from chowders, fish cakes, and lobster or crab rolls to chicken pot pie, meat loaf, and New England--style boiled dinners to wild Maine blueberry, custard, or apple pie. There's a gift shop on the other side of the parking lot, as well as rental cabins and a motel just up the hill.

Red's Eats

$$$ Fodor's choice

The customers lined up beside this little red shack at the bottom of Wiscasset's Main Street, just before the bridge across the Sheepscot River, have come from far and wide for one of the Maine Coast's best lobster rolls—namely, a perfectly buttered and griddled split-top roll that's absolutely, positively stuffed with fresh, sweet meat and served with melted butter and mayo on the side. Devotees swear that the wait (up to two hours!) is worth it, and it helps that staffers hand out ice water, popsicles, umbrellas to protect from rain or hot sun, and even dog biscuits for the pups. You can also get your lobster in a gluten-free roll or on a plate without any bread. Other choices include crab rolls, hamburgers, and onion rings, as well as clams or other local seafood fried in house-made batters. Enjoy your hard-earned feast at a table on the bilevel deck behind the shack or at a picnic table on the grass by the water. For a shorter wait, come on a weekday at an off hour (not lunch or dinner time).

41 Water St., Wiscasset, Maine, 04578, USA
207-882–6128
Known For
  • more than a whole lobster goes into each roll
  • the unholy "Puff Dog," a hot dog loaded with bacon and cheese and deep-fried
  • long lines in summer, especially on weekends
Restaurants Details
Rate Includes: Closed late-Oct.–mid-Apr., Reservations not accepted

Shannon's Unshelled

$ Fodor's choice

The namesake of this shack first got the idea to set up shop when her father posed the simple question: “Where can you buy a quick lobster roll in Boothbay Harbor?” Unable to answer, Shannon’s Unshelled was born, and the shack is now beloved for its grilled, buttered buns stuffed with whole lobsters and served with a side of garlicky, sea-salted, drawn butter.

The Block Saloon

$$ Fodor's choice

The menu at this late-afternoon-into-late-evening spot is limited and changes frequently, but it's always good. Order a small plate or charcuterie board, or go bigger with something like risotto, ramen, or seared pork shoulder with roasted shallots and toasted pistachios. Sunday brunch is popular, thanks to such choices as molasses pancakes, deviled eggs with smoked trout, and gougeres served with candied bacon. Accompany your food with a cool craft cocktail, Maine beer (several on draft), or a glass of wine.

The Deck Bar & Grill

$$ Fodor's choice

Located at Linekin Bay Resort, this casual, mostly outdoor restaurant offers a serene waterside setting coupled with fresh lobster rolls, haddock BLTs, mussels, crab cakes, crudo yellowfin tuna, fish tacos, and clams linguine. There are plenty of meat, gluten-free, and vegan options, too. The resort and the restaurant are only a few minutes' drive east of downtown Boothbay Harbor, but the chill atmosphere seems a million miles away. There's often live music on weekends.

The Sea Gull Shop and Restaurant

$$ Fodor's choice

Try for a table by the windows in the small dining room of this little landmark restaurant, perched beside Pemaquid Lighthouse at the very edge of the rocky shore. Blueberry pancakes with Maine maple syrup are the clear breakfast favorites; the lunch and dinner menu features fried fresh seafood, lobster and crab rolls, salads, and mouthwatering entrées like the shipwreck pie (lobster, crab, shrimp, and scallops sautéed in butter and topped with a cracker-crumb crust). Desserts include ice cream and homemade pies or strawberry or blueberry shortcake. Alcoholic beverages aren't served, but you're welcome to bring your own. The gift shop is packed jewelry, Maine-made jams and condiments, prints of local scenery, and other great souvenirs.

Water Street Kitchen and Bar

$$$ Fodor's choice

Step into this welcoming, airy space, and settle at a table with a view of the Sheepscot River to enjoy local seafood, meats, and produce. Many of the pastas, paellas, and risottos have a Mediterranean flavor; other dishes showcase the chef's creative approach to modern American cuisine. There's also a raw bar. Light eaters appreciate the option of ordering a half-portion of any of the pasta dishes.

Barn Door Baking Company Cafe

$

Connected to Sherman's Maine Coast Book Shop through an arched doorway, this little café turns out excellent coffee and hot and cold coffee drinks, plus fresh-from-the-oven sweet and savory baked items. It's hard to choose among the scones, slices of cake and pie, sinful cookies, cupcakes, and old-fashioned dessert bars. For a light lunch, go for a wedge of quiche or baked-in-house bread, toasted and topped with house-made salmon spread, hummus, or avocado.

Beale Street Barbecue

$

Ribs are the thing at one of Maine's oldest barbecue joints, opened in 1996. Hearty eaters should ask for one of the platters piled high with pulled pork, pulled chicken, or shredded beef.

215 Water St., Bath, Maine, 04530, USA
207-442–9514
Known For
  • three-cheese mac and cheese (American, cheddar, and Pecorino romano)
  • Maine microbrews
  • Key lime pie
Restaurants Details
Rate Includes: Credit cards accepted

Best Thai Restaurant

$$

This aptly named, family-run restaurant serves all the standard Thai favorites, as well as some lesser-known options. Everything is prepared using fresh local fish, meats, and produce. In addition to indoor dining, there's a small patio just outside the front door.

88 Main St., Damariscotta, Maine, 04543, USA
207-563–1440
Known For
  • very friendly service
  • local ingredients
  • exceptional Thai cooking
Restaurants Details
Rate Includes: Closed Mon.

Boathouse Bistro Tapas Bar and Restaurant

$$

Austrian-born chef-owner Karin Guerin dishes up intriguing, tapas-style small plates—from mojito ginger wings to Madagascar beef skewers—as well as full-size risotto, vegetarian, vegan, and seafood entrées. Be sure to try the fried oysters in vichyssoise sauce with flying-fish roe. On a fine summer day, the open-air rooftop and bar is a wonderful spot to dine.

12 The By-Way, Boothbay Harbor, Maine, 04538, USA
207-633–0400
Known For
  • great views from rooftop dining area and bar
  • internationally inspired tapas
  • unusual preparations of local seafood
Restaurants Details
Rate Includes: Closed Thurs. and mid-Oct.–mid-Apr.

Boothbay Lobster Wharf

$$$

This is the real deal—a working lobster wharf where fishermen unload their catch to be sold at the on-site fish market or incorporated into the lobster rolls, crab rolls, or fried seafood dishes that are served to diners on the dock and in the enclosed dining room. If you opt for the steamed lobster dinner, you get to choose your crustacean from a saltwater tank. There's live music every Friday and weekends. And if you're an oyster fan, head here for your fill of buck-a-shuck oysters Friday and Saturday evening. The view across the boat-filled harbor isn't bad, either.

97 Atlantic Ave., Boothbay Harbor, Maine, 04538, USA
207-633–4900
Known For
  • ultrafresh seafood
  • buck-a-shuck oysters on Friday and Saturday night
  • great harbor views
Restaurants Details
Rate Includes: Closed early Oct.–late May

Broad Arrow Tavern

$$$

On the main floor of the Harraseeket Inn, this dark, wood-paneled tavern with mounted moose heads, decoys, snowshoes, and other outdoor sporty decor is known for both its casual nature and its menu. The chefs use organic, mostly Maine produce, meat, and seafood in all the dishes, including the pizzas made in a wood-fired oven. About the only non-Maine ingredient is the wild salmon, which comes from Alaska and Oregon.

Coastal Prime

$$$$

Yachts in the marina nose right up against the outdoor dining deck, and large windows frame the harbor in the elegant indoor dining room and casual bar. Complementing the views are the exceptional sandwiches, salads, pizzas, and tacos served at lunch and the oysters, lobster, sushi, and steaks served at dinner. If it's a special occasion, go for the ultimate surf-and-turf meal: a 10-ounce Wagyu strip steak with butter-poached lobster.

Cook's Lobster and Ale House

$$$

What began as a lobster shack in 1955 has grown into a large, well-known, family-style restaurant with a sizable menu that is predictably heavy on local seafood (lobster boats unload their catch at a dock here) but also has plenty of choices for landlubbers. A shore dinner will set you back close to $50, but you won't leave hungry after a 1¼-pound lobster, steamed clams, drawn butter, and corn on the cob. If you want to focus just on the lobster, you can order a bug weighing up to 5 pounds! Whether you choose indoor or deck seating, you can watch as the lobstermen come and go and the boats sail across the bay. Expect this place to be packed at the height of the season. 

68 Garrison Cove Rd., Bailey Island, Maine, 04003, USA
207-833–2818
Known For
  • traditional Maine seafood fare prepared simply
  • great water views
  • live music and a festive atmosphere in the summer
Restaurants Details
Rate Includes: Closed Mon. and Tues.

Day's Crabmeat & Lobster

$$

People have been stopping at this roadside lobster pound for a century, buying live or cooked lobsters to take home, or ordering a lobster or crabmeat roll, lobster stew, lobster dinner, steamed or fried fresh clams, and other local seafood to enjoy at a picnic table overlooking a serene salt marsh. It's just a few miles down the road from Freeport's Main Street shops, but it feels a world apart.

1269 U.S. 1, Maine, 04096, USA
207-846–5871
Known For
  • wetlands views
  • low-key, old-fashioned atmosphere
  • fresh seafood at fair prices
Restaurants Details
Rate Includes: Closed Sept.–mid-Apr.

Eventide Specialties

$

Just up the hill from the harbor, this goodie-filled shop is the ideal place to pick up picnic supplies. Large, made-to-order sandwiches (the chicken salad with apples and cranberries is divine) come on a choice of freshly baked breads, including sourdough, anadama, and three-Italian cheese. What's more, every sandwich is accompanied by a pickle—and a chocolate! The shop stocks a great selection of cheeses and wines, and there are plenty of baked treats for dessert, too. A daily menu of prepared entrées and soups would also be perfect for supper at your cottage.

Fat Boy Drive-In

$

Pull your car up under the green awning and turn on your vehicle’s lights to catch the attention of the servers at this retro drive-in restaurant. The eatery's BLT made with Canadian bacon is a longtime favorite that pairs well with onion rings and a frappe (try the blueberry), but baskets of fried clams and shrimp are also winners, and there are several burger options. Your order will be brought to your car or, if you prefer, to a nearby picnic table. It’s as fun as it sounds!

FlipSide Coffee

$

This local gathering spot sells a variety of hot and cold coffee and tea drinks, plus an appealing selection of light meals. Breakfast choices include a curried rice bowl, nachos, and avocado toast; at lunch, there are wraps and better-than-average salads. 

Harborside 1901 Bar & Grill

$$$

You just might want to eat dessert first when you spy the display case of cheesecakes, mousses, and profiteroles. But there are lots of savory temptations, too, including a large selection of sushi, tacos (lobster, shrimp, octopus, or haddock), and land and sea dinner entrées. There's no outdoor dining, but the outer dining room has windows overlooking the harbor.

Harraseeket Lunch and Lobster Co.

$$

Take a break from Main Street's bustle and drive 3 scenic miles to South Freeport, where this popular, bare-bones, counter-service place sits beside the town landing and serves up seafood baskets and lobster dinners. Save room for strawberry shortcake, blueberry crisp, bread pudding, whoopie pies, or another of the homemade desserts. Lines can be long.

King Eider's Pub and Restaurant

$$$$

At this restaurant in an adorable building just off Main Street, the acclaimed crab cakes and the oysters fresh from the Damariscotta River are good bets, but so are the steak-and-ale pie, seafood stew, and fish-and-chips (made with fresh haddock that's sautéed rather than fried). With exposed-brick walls and low, wood-beamed ceilings hung with pottery beer mugs, the downstairs is a snug place to enjoy a Maine craft ale.

Little Dog Coffee Shop

$

The coffee is freshly roasted and richly flavorful, the baked goods are straight from the oven, and the atmosphere is chill. Have a muffin or croissant, select from several toasties with imaginative fillings, or try the delicious avocado toast on homemade wheat bread. Wash it down with a really good iced latte. If you're in a hurry, select from the grab-and-go burrito menu.

Mae's Cafe

$

This charming café offers several indoor spaces, plus a deck—built around a giant maple tree!—where you can enjoy homemade eggs Benedict, omelets, and breakfast sandwiches, as well as wraps, salads, soups, chowders, and smoothies. Everything is creative, and everything is homemade.

Maine Beer Company

$$

Of the half dozen breweries in Freeport, the Maine Beer Company is a standout. Its beer is well crafted, as are its salads, charcuterie, and wood-fired pizzas, and you can dine indoors or out. It's a popular place, so reservations are recommended, though not required. Every year, the owners donate a percentage of profits to charitable organizations.